He always talks about missions and guns and everything but I've never seen any paper work(He says it was burned). He seems very "for real" but he won't take out a VA loan for our frist house and won't use the VA hospital(we don't have insurence) I would really like to know before we get married.
He says he was a E-4 Gunners Mate?????? Is he being serious or just blowing up smoke? Answers (1)Eric Michael Allen

He can obtain his records from the Navy or the National Personnel Records Center. You could make a FOIA (Freedom of Information Act) request to get an informational copy of his DD-214 or other records, however much of the information would be redacted or withheld due to the Privacy Act. He can obtain copies of any of his paperwork. He may not be eligible for a VA home loan, due to not fully completing his term of his service.
